머 일단 요청에 의해서 뜯어보기는 했지만... 영 꺼림직한게;;
언제적 만드신 작품인지는 모르겠지만 만드느라 애좀먹었을거 같네요.
체력 출력하는건 처음보는 방식이라 저도 구경좀 했습니다. 이렇게 만들어도 되는군요;;
먼저 말씀드리자면 이렇게 만들려면 노력없이는 힘들겁니다.
체력의 표시는 1~9까지 숫자를 그려서 픽쳐로 저장합니다.
그다음에 이분이 하신대로 설명을 하자면
현제 최대체력을 변수에다가 저장합니다 그리고 그 변수값이 얼만지 읽어 들이는거죠.
괴도샤른님은 999까지가 최고였나 봅니다. 검사해서 999이하 900이상이면
첫번째 숫자가 9니까 9자를 출력해주는거죠. 그리고 다시 해당변수에서 900을 빼줍니다.
이렇게 해서 9 ~ 1까지 갑니다.
그리고 다시 99이하 ~ 90 이상 인지 조건분기로 검사합니다.
맞다면 다시 두번째 위치에 9짜를 출력해주고 90을 빼주죠.
이렇게하면 자신의 최대체력을 나타낼수가 있죠...
그리고 앞부분에는 같은 형식으로 최대체력이 아닌 현제 체력을 넣어서 만들면 됩니다.
데미지 띄우는것도 비슷합니다. 몬스터를 팻을때 나오는 데미지값을 변수로 저장해서
그걸로 픽쳐를 띄우는거죠.
아마 이해가 잘안되시리라 보는데 이래저래 다른분이 만드신거 따라도 해보시고
강좌도 보시고 해서 연습해보시길...;; 아무래도 이거보다 더 간단하게 설명하기는 힘들거 같네요.
잘모르시겠거나 난해 하시면 쪽지나 리플달아주세욤